13 O LORD our God, other masters besides Thee have ruled us; But through Thee alone we confess Thy name.

14 The dead will not live, the departed spirits will not rise; Therefore Thou hast punished and destroyed them, And Thou hast wiped out all remembrance of them.

15 Thou hast increased the nation, O LORD, Thou hast increased the nation, Thou art glorified; Thou hast extended all the borders of the land.

16 O LORD, they sought Thee in distress; They could only whisper a prayer, Thy chastening was upon them.

17 As the pregnant woman approaches the time to give birth, She writhes and cries out in her labor pains, Thus were we before Thee, O LORD.

18 We were pregnant, we writhed in labor, We gave birth, as it were, only to wind. We could not accomplish deliverance for the earth Nor were inhabitants of the world born.

19 Your dead will live; Their corpses will rise. You who lie in the dust, awake and shout for joy, For your dew is as the dew of the dawn, And the earth will give birth to the departed spirits.

20 Come, my people, enter into your rooms, And close your doors behind you; Hide for a little while, Until indignation runs its course.

21 For behold, the LORD is about to come out from His place To punish the inhabitants of the earth for their iniquity; And the earth will reveal her bloodshed, And will no longer cover her slain.
